mia-3ddistance - Evaluate the distance between two binary shapes.

Description

mia-3ddistance  This  program takes two binary masks as input and evaluates the distance of one mask with
       respect to the other in voxel space. The output is given as text file with the coordinates of the  source
       voxels and their distance to the reference mask. Correction for voxel size must be done after processing.

Example

       Evaluate  the  distance  of the mask given in the images srcXXXX.png to the mask given in refXXXX.png and
       save the result to distances.txt

       mia-3ddistance -i srcXXXX.png -r refXXXX.png -o distances.txt

Options

FileIO
              -i --in-file=(input, required); string
                     input image(s) that contain the source pixel mask

              -r --ref-file=(input, required); string
                     reference mask to evaluate the distance from

              -o --out-file=(output, required); string
                     output file name

   Processing
                 --threads=-1
                     Maxiumum number of threads to use for processing,This number should be lower  or  equal  to
                     the number of logical processor cores in the machine. (-1: automatic estimation).

Synopsis

mia-3ddistance-i<in-file>-r<ref-file>-o<out-file>[options]
